当前位置: 首页 > news >正文

3分钟快速上手QKeyMapper:Windows平台终极按键映射解决方案

3分钟快速上手QKeyMapper:Windows平台终极按键映射解决方案

【免费下载链接】QKeyMapper[按键映射工具] QKeyMapper,Qt开发Win10&Win11可用,不修改注册表、不需重新启动系统,可立即生效和停止。支持游戏手柄映射到键鼠,手柄摇杆控制鼠标移动,键鼠映射到虚拟游戏手柄,鼠标控制虚拟手柄移动摇杆等功能。项目地址: https://gitcode.com/gh_mirrors/qk/QKeyMapper

还在为游戏操作不顺手而烦恼吗?想用手柄玩PC游戏,或是用键盘模拟手柄操作?QKeyMapper正是你需要的开源按键映射神器!这款基于Qt开发的Windows工具能在键盘、鼠标、游戏手柄和虚拟手柄之间实现全方位映射,无需修改注册表,即开即用,让你的操作体验瞬间升级。

🎯 传统痛点与QKeyMapper的革新方案

传统按键映射工具要么需要修改系统注册表,要么安装复杂驱动,甚至需要重启电脑。QKeyMapper彻底改变了这一现状,采用内存级映射技术,所有操作实时生效,安全无残留。

传统方法的问题

  • 需要修改系统注册表,存在风险
  • 安装驱动复杂,兼容性差
  • 修改后需要重启系统
  • 功能单一,不支持多设备映射

QKeyMapper的优势

  • 完全在内存中运行,不修改系统设置
  • 无需安装驱动(基础功能)
  • 即时生效,随时停止
  • 支持键盘、鼠标、物理手柄、虚拟手柄全方位映射

🚀 核心功能深度解析

游戏手柄映射到键盘鼠标

QKeyMapper最强大的功能之一就是让游戏手柄控制键盘和鼠标。无论是Xbox手柄、PS4/5手柄还是Switch Pro手柄,都能完美识别并映射到任意按键。

实战案例:用手柄玩键盘游戏

  1. 将手柄的A键映射到键盘空格键(跳跃)
  2. 将手柄的B键映射到键盘E键(互动)
  3. 将手柄的右摇杆映射到鼠标移动(视角控制)
  4. 将手柄的LT/RT扳机键映射到鼠标左右键

键盘鼠标映射到虚拟游戏手柄

对于只支持手柄的游戏,QKeyMapper可以创建虚拟游戏手柄,让你用键盘鼠标操作。通过ViGEmBus驱动,实现键盘鼠标到虚拟手柄的完美转换。

虚拟手柄设置步骤

  1. 点击"虚拟游戏手柄"标签页
  2. 安装ViGEmBus驱动(只需一次)
  3. 启用虚拟手柄功能
  4. 在映射表中添加"vJoy-"开头的虚拟手柄按键

高级功能:按键序列与宏录制

QKeyMapper支持复杂的按键序列,让你一键触发多个操作。这对于游戏连招、办公自动化非常实用。

连招宏示例

↓A⏱50»↓B⏱50»↑B⏱20»↑A

这个序列表示:按下A键50ms → 按下B键50ms → 抬起B键20ms → 抬起A键

宏录制功能

  1. 在"映射项设定"窗口中点击"按键录制"按钮
  2. 按下F11开始录制
  3. 执行你想要录制的按键操作
  4. 按下F12停止录制
  5. 录制结果自动复制到剪贴板

📱 虚拟按钮面板:创新的触屏式操作体验

QKeyMapper v1.3.8版本新增了虚拟按钮面板功能,让你可以用鼠标点击虚拟按钮来触发映射。这个功能特别适合触摸屏用户,或者需要快速切换多个功能的场景。

虚拟按钮面板设置

  1. 在原始按键中选择"VButton{标签名}"
  2. 在"映射设定"标签页点击"虚拟按钮面板设定"
  3. 调整布局:设置行列数、颜色、透明度
  4. 设置显示位置:左上、右上、左下、右下
  5. 使用"ShowVButtonPanel"和"HideVButtonPanel"映射键控制显示/隐藏

🔧 不同使用场景的解决方案

游戏玩家:优化操作体验

场景1:手柄玩PC游戏

  • 问题:PC游戏不支持手柄,但你想用手柄舒适操作
  • 方案:用手柄映射到键盘鼠标,保持手柄操作习惯
  • 配置:ahk_utils/script/目录下的脚本辅助

场景2:键盘优化布局

  • 问题:游戏默认按键不符合操作习惯
  • 方案:重新映射键盘按键,打造个性化布局
  • 技巧:使用"锁定功能"实现持续按键

场景3:一键连招

  • 问题:复杂连招需要快速按键组合
  • 方案:使用按键序列功能,一键触发多个操作
  • 示例:格斗游戏必杀技、MMO游戏技能链

办公用户:提升工作效率

场景1:自定义快捷键

  • 问题:软件快捷键冲突或不方便
  • 方案:重新映射快捷键到更顺手的位置
  • 技巧:使用"Run"映射键配合ahk_utils/工具脚本

场景2:多软件协同

  • 问题:需要在多个软件间频繁切换
  • 方案:设置全局快捷键,快速切换软件
  • 配置:使用正则表达式匹配多个软件进程

场景3:自动化操作

  • 问题:重复性操作耗时费力
  • 方案:录制宏,一键完成复杂操作
  • 应用:数据录入、报表生成、批量处理

特殊需求:无障碍辅助

场景1:单手操作

  • 问题:因故只能单手操作电脑
  • 方案:将常用功能映射到单手可及位置
  • 技巧:使用虚拟按钮面板,鼠标点击操作

场景2:设备适配

  • 问题:特殊输入设备需要适配
  • 方案:任意设备映射到标准输入
  • 支持:游戏手柄、轨迹球、触摸板等

🎮 高级技巧深度解析

正则表达式高级匹配

QKeyMapper支持正则表达式匹配,实现更精确的进程和窗口识别。这对于多版本游戏、多语言界面非常有用。

进程匹配示例

  • 匹配多个游戏版本:(Game1|Game2|Game3)\.exe$
  • 匹配Steam游戏:[A-Z]:\\.*\\steamapps\\common\\GameName\\Game\.exe$

窗口标题匹配

  • 匹配特定开头:^我的游戏
  • 匹配多语言:^(My Game|我的游戏)

陀螺仪控制鼠标

如果你的手柄支持陀螺仪(如DS4、DS5手柄),QKeyMapper可以让你用手柄的陀螺仪控制鼠标移动。

陀螺仪设置

  1. 添加原始按键:"Joy-Gyro2Mouse"
  2. 在"陀螺仪鼠标"标签页调整水平和垂直速度
  3. 使用"Gyro2Mouse-Hold"和"Gyro2Mouse-Move"控制开关
  4. 调整"回中延时"参数,优化控制体验

鼠标控制虚拟摇杆

对于不支持鼠标视角的游戏,可以用鼠标控制虚拟摇杆,实现类似鼠标控制的体验。

鼠标控制设置

  1. 添加原始按键:"vJoy-Mouse2LS"(鼠标控制左摇杆)
  2. 调整"X轴灵敏度"和"Y轴灵敏度"参数
  3. 设置"回中延时",控制摇杆归零速度
  4. 测试不同游戏的最佳灵敏度设置

📊 性能优化与最佳实践

系统配置建议

Windows筛选键设置(强烈建议开启):

  • Win10:设置 → 轻松使用 → 键盘 → 筛选键
  • Win11:设置 → 辅助功能 → 键盘 → 筛选键

开启筛选键可以避免Windows系统重复发送同一按键,确保映射功能稳定运行。

资源占用优化

QKeyMapper采用高效的内存管理,运行时占用资源极少。但使用以下功能时需要注意:

  1. 多设备支持:使用Interception驱动时,避免频繁插拔USB设备
  2. 虚拟手柄:ViGEmBus驱动与vJoy驱动不要同时安装
  3. 进程监控:关闭不需要的进程监控,减少CPU占用

常见问题解决方案

问题1:映射后按键无反应

  • 检查是否开启了"开始映射"
  • 确认前台窗口与映射配置匹配
  • 尝试重启QKeyMapper
  • 检查Windows筛选键是否开启

问题2:手柄映射不生效

  • 确认手柄已正确连接
  • 检查手柄驱动是否安装
  • 尝试重新插拔手柄
  • 测试手柄在Windows游戏控制器中是否正常

问题3:虚拟手柄功能异常

  • 确认ViGEmBus驱动已正确安装
  • 检查是否有其他虚拟手柄软件冲突
  • Win7系统需要安装特定版本的ViGEmBus
  • 重启电脑后重新安装驱动

🛠️ 实用工具脚本与自动化

QKeyMapper附带了一系列实用工具脚本,位于ahk_utils/目录下,可以与"Run"映射键配合使用,实现自动化操作。

窗口管理工具

  • winmove.ahk- 调整窗口大小和位置
  • active_window.ahk- 激活指定窗口
  • config_window.ahk- 配置窗口属性

输入法工具

  • switch_ime.ahk- 快速切换输入法
  • show_ime_hkl.ahk- 显示当前输入法

鼠标工具

  • mouse_position.ahk- 保存和恢复鼠标位置
  • move_window.ahk- 移动窗口到指定位置

集成示例

  1. 将"Run"映射键设置为运行ahk_utils/script/switch_ime.ahk
  2. 绑定到快捷键,如Ctrl+Shift+Space
  3. 一键切换中英文输入法

🔍 安全性验证与社区支持

安全性验证

QKeyMapper经过多引擎病毒扫描,确保软件安全可靠。VirScan平台46种引擎扫描结果显示,0种检测出病毒,证明软件纯净无恶意代码。

项目结构与资源

QKeyMapper项目结构清晰,便于用户理解和扩展:

  • src/- 源代码目录,基于Qt开发
  • image/- 图标和图片资源
  • translations/- 多语言翻译文件(中文、英文、日文)
  • ahk_utils/- 实用工具脚本
  • screenshot/- 软件截图和示例图片

学习资源与文档

官方文档

  • 按键名称对照表 - 完整的按键名称参考
  • 正则表达式指南 - 高级匹配规则说明
  • 组合键支持列表 - 支持的组合键列表

学习路径建议

  1. 从简单开始:先尝试基本的键盘到键盘映射
  2. 逐步深入:掌握后再尝试手柄映射和虚拟手柄
  3. 利用模板:参考映射表模版文件夹中的示例配置
  4. 社区交流:加入用户社区获取帮助和分享经验

🚀 未来发展与技术展望

技术发展方向

QKeyMapper持续更新,未来版本将加入更多创新功能:

  1. 云端同步:映射配置云端存储,多设备同步
  2. AI智能映射:根据使用习惯自动优化映射方案
  3. 更多设备支持:扩展支持更多输入设备类型
  4. 跨平台支持:考虑Linux和macOS版本开发

社区生态建设

QKeyMapper作为开源项目,欢迎开发者贡献代码和用户分享配置:

  1. 配置分享平台:用户上传和下载映射配置
  2. 插件系统:第三方开发者开发功能插件
  3. 教程视频:制作视频教程,降低学习门槛
  4. 多语言支持:增加更多语言界面翻译

用户体验优化

未来版本将重点优化用户体验:

  1. 界面现代化:更新UI设计,提升视觉效果
  2. 操作简化:简化复杂功能的操作步骤
  3. 智能提示:根据使用场景提供智能建议
  4. 性能优化:进一步降低资源占用

🎯 总结:为什么选择QKeyMapper?

QKeyMapper与其他按键映射工具相比,有以下几个独特优势:

  1. 完全免费开源:基于GPLv3协议,代码完全开放透明
  2. 无需安装驱动:大部分功能无需安装额外驱动
  3. 即时生效:修改映射后立即生效,无需重启
  4. 多设备支持:支持键盘、鼠标、物理手柄、虚拟手柄
  5. 高度可定制:支持按键序列、连发、锁定等高级功能
  6. 正则匹配:支持复杂的窗口匹配规则
  7. 虚拟按钮:创新的虚拟按钮面板功能
  8. 安全可靠:经过严格病毒扫描,无恶意代码

无论你是游戏玩家想要优化操作,还是办公用户需要自定义快捷键,QKeyMapper都能满足你的需求。它的灵活性和强大功能,让按键映射变得简单而高效。

现在就开始使用QKeyMapper,释放你的设备潜力,打造专属的操作体验!记住,最好的配置永远是适合自己操作习惯的配置,多尝试、多调整,找到最适合你的映射方案。

开始使用

  1. 从项目仓库下载最新版本
  2. 解压文件,运行QKeyMapper.exe
  3. 按照本文指南配置你的第一个映射
  4. 探索高级功能,打造个性化操作方案

QKeyMapper不仅是一个工具,更是提升工作效率和游戏体验的利器。开始你的按键映射之旅,发现更多可能性!

【免费下载链接】QKeyMapper[按键映射工具] QKeyMapper,Qt开发Win10&Win11可用,不修改注册表、不需重新启动系统,可立即生效和停止。支持游戏手柄映射到键鼠,手柄摇杆控制鼠标移动,键鼠映射到虚拟游戏手柄,鼠标控制虚拟手柄移动摇杆等功能。项目地址: https://gitcode.com/gh_mirrors/qk/QKeyMapper

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.zskr.cn/news/1510556.html

相关文章:

  • (Arcgis)matlab编程批量处理hdf5格式转换为tif格式
  • 视觉多向量检索技术:突破传统文档检索的局限
  • 德宏傣族景颇族自治州2026年黄金回收白银回收铂金回收权威门店 TOP5+正规可靠机构电话与地址汇总 - 马刺总冠军
  • (Arcgis)matlab编程批量处理hdf4格式转换为tif格式
  • 基于昇腾 CANN 与昇腾NPU asc-devkit 仓库,详细讲解 Ascend C 算子编程语言的环境准备、内核实现、编译运行全流程,配合真实代码示例与效率对比,帮助开发者快速掌握昇腾 NPU
  • 2026保定本地人认可的 5 家户外广告设施检测机构实地测评汇总+市民高频选择 - 中安检测集团
  • MC3S12R系列汽车级MCU:ROM掩膜、CAN与高可靠嵌入式设计解析
  • MAPK/ERK信号通路:从基础生物学到人类疾病的核心枢纽
  • QueryExcel完整指南:如何5分钟内完成上百个Excel文件的批量查询
  • BitTorrent下载终极提速指南:如何用trackerslist突破速度瓶颈
  • Windows下可直接运行的C语言螺旋矩阵生成VS工程(支持手动输入阶数)
  • 宜昌市2026年本地黄金回收铂金白银回收哪家强?TOP5 正规门店榜单 +联系方式 - 嵩山路大王
  • 2026蚌埠商户及市民高频选择的 5 家食品检测第三方机构实地测评整理 - 科信检测
  • 如何高效处理海量数据:QueryExcel批量查询工具的完整指南
  • 舟山黄金白银回收铂金旧金回收无套路门店 TOP 榜单 实地测评资料整理(更新时间:2026-06-12_11:10:26) - 诚金汇钻回收公司
  • 2026昌吉建筑材料检测权威机构排行 TOP 建材检测 + 见证取样 + 主体结构检测 附电话地址 - 中检检测集团
  • 宜春市2026年本地黄金回收铂金白银回收哪家强?TOP5 正规门店榜单 +联系方式 - 嵩山路大王
  • 深入解析DSC数字信号控制器:从56800E内核到电机控制实战
  • WaveTools鸣潮工具箱:3分钟解锁120FPS,全面提升你的游戏体验
  • MATLAB非线性方程组求解工具包:牛顿法与梯度下降法双实现,开箱即用
  • 昆明市2026年本地黄金回收铂金白银回收哪家强?TOP5 正规门店榜单 +联系方式 - 开始就结束
  • MPC5121e嵌入式处理器架构解析与汽车电子/工业控制应用实践
  • 5个理由告诉你:为什么免费开源的GanttProject是项目管理最佳选择
  • 跨境电商独立站0-1搭建全流程
  • 3步终结游戏卡顿:ACE-Guard资源限制器终极指南
  • Plain Craft Launcher 2:高效解决Minecraft启动问题的完整指南
  • 深入解析NXP MIFARE SAM AV2硬件安全模块:架构、安全设计与多卡并行处理
  • OpenCL图像对象创建、映射与读写操作详解与性能优化
  • 湘潭黄金白银回收铂金旧金回收无套路门店 TOP 榜单 实地测评资料整理(更新时间:2026-06-12_11:10:26) - 诚金汇钻回收公司
  • 终极MMD Tools完整指南:如何在Blender中实现专业级MMD动画工作流